    Default HELP!! I just got a Gritzner Durlach handcrank sewing machine!

    Today I bought a Gritzner Durlach handcrank machine at a yard sale. I have read that they are patterned after the Singer 12, but know little more than that about them. Any one know where the serial numbers are found on the machine?
    My machine is black and has most of the gold trims worn off, but the Mother of Pearl flower design is in the center of the machine and has a little chip out of the design. There is a Mother of Pearl border around the base of the machine. It has more of a fancy coffin case top rather than just the bentwood cases of the Singer 99's.
    I am sorry that I can't post pictures of it. Any information that anyone can give me as to how to date it and where to get the threading instructions for it would be helpful. I went to the Singer site and asked for the Singer 12 instructions, and it showed 101-12, or something like that. What size needle does it take? Where can I get some? I NEED HELP!!!

    I did find out from Mizkaki, Cathy, that I can use an industrial needle DBX1 needle in my machine instead of the 12-1, which is supposed to be a lot easier to find. I put an e-bay link on another thread here showing what my machine would look like if it was in worse shape. Mine doesn't have all of the chipped paint that the one in the picture does.
